  VC    motivations
    Driven by their model
    Impacts their terms and expectations
  Most   companies aren’t VC’able
    Just don’t fit the “Big Money” model
    May be good companies and businesses
  But
     if you are than you’ll be better
  equipped than most because of tonight
  1,000 companies
  10 investments
    2 may be widely successful (usually 1)
    6 “land of the living dead”
    2 fail horribly
  Winners to offset my losers
  Start ups 10-12x return in 5-7
                                years
  Existing companies 5-7x in 4-5 years
  A company that doubles isn’t enough…
  Every opportunity has to have the
 potential to be a home run
  YouTube sold to Google for $1.65 Billion
  Sequoia invested $11.5M received $495M
    30% of the company
  43xreturn
  Great deal!
  6-9 months to raise     capital
  Several meetings
   Want to get to know you
   Assess your “Say/Do” factor
   Close to truth
    ▪  Builds confidence
  Personal Recommendation:
     Get to know the VC
   ▪  Process (who makes the decision, when & how
      often)
   ▪  Where are they in their fund life cycle
   ▪  What was their last deal
   ▪  Talk to their existing CEO
   ▪  Cash available to invest/reserves
   ▪  No “Yes” means “No”
   Have to be able to live with them “til exit do
   you part”
  Non-binding offer to invest
  Outlines the general terms    and conditions
  of investment
    Which may change
  Not the definitive agreement, simply a
   place to start
  Everyone uses it

  Preferred   shares
    Accrue
    Price + dividend convert
  Protects   an investor from down round
    As if their investment had been done at the
     current lower price
    Keeps the investor whole in bad times
    Full-ratchet
    Weighted average
  VC  can ask to have the company buy
   back shares
  Life of the fund
  Investors in funds want their money back
  Outcome:
   Forces a sale
   Get minimum investment back (P+dividends)
